2000-04-11 Federico Mena Quintero <federico@helixcode.com> Most of this patch is based on a patch by Havoc Pennington (hp@redhat.com) to make GdkPixbuf's structures opaque and to remove the libart dependency. * gdk-pixbuf/gdk-pixbuf.h: Removed the public structures. (GdkColorspace): New enum that for now only contains GDK_COLORSPACE_RGB. (GdkPixbufDestroyNotify): New type for the pixbuf's pixels destroy notification function. (GdkInterpType): New num with interpolation types. * *.[ch]: Replace the libart stuff with our own stuff. * pixops/*.[ch]: Likewise. * gdk-pixbuf/gdk-pixbuf-private.h: New file with the private declarations of the GdkPixbuf structures. * gdk-pixbuf/gdk-pixbuf.c (gdk_pixbuf_new_from_art_pixbuf): Removed function. (gdk_pixbuf_get_format): Constify. (gdk_pixbuf_get_n_channels): Constify. (gdk_pixbuf_get_has_alpha): Constify. (gdk_pixbuf_get_bits_per_sample): Constify. (gdk_pixbuf_get_pixels): Constify. (gdk_pixbuf_get_width): Constify. (gdk_pixbuf_get_height): Constify. (gdk_pixbuf_get_rowstride): Constify. * gdk-pixbuf/gdk-pixbuf.c (gdk_pixbuf_copy): New function to copy a pixbuf. * gdk-pixbuf/gdk-pixbuf-data.c (gdk_pixbuf_new_from_data): Added a bits_per_sample argument; currently only 8 bits per sample are supported. * gdk-pixbuf/gdk-pixbuf-animation.c (gdk_pixbuf_frame_get_pixbuf): New accessor. (gdk_pixbuf_frame_get_x_offset): New accessor. (gdk_pixbuf_frame_get_y_offset): New accessor. (gdk_pixbuf_frame_get_delay_time): New accessor. (gdk_pixbuf_frame_get_action): New accessor. * gdk-pixbuf/gdk-pixbuf-render.c (gdk_pixbuf_render_pixmap_and_mask): Instead of returning a solid mask rectangle for pixbufs without an alpha channel, set the *mask_return to NULL. * gdk-pixbuf/gdk-pixbuf-util.c (gdk_pixbuf_add_alpha): Constify. * gdk-pixbuf/gdk-pixbuf-scale.c: Fix includes. * gdk-pixbuf/gdk-pixbuf-scale.c (gdk_pixbuf_scale): Added some preconditions. Maybe we should also check for the colorspace, bits per pixel, and such. (gdk_pixbuf_composite): Likewise. (gdk_pixbuf_composite_color): Likewise. (gdk_pixbuf_scale_simple): Likewise, and fail gracefully if we cannot allocate the new pixbuf. (gdk_pixbuf_composite_color_simple): Likewise. * gdk-pixbuf/gnome-canvas-pixbuf.c (gnome_canvas_pixbuf_render): Use art_rgb_rgba_affine() or art_rgb_affine() since we no longer have an ArtPixBuf. * gdk-pixbuf/io-bmp.c: Fix includes. * gdk-pixbuf/pixops/pixops.c (pixops_scale_nearest): Fixed cast in an lvalue. * TODO: Populated. * configure.in: Removed checks for libart. * gdk-pixbuf/Makefile.am: Removed references to libart. (noinst_HEADERS): Added gdk-pixbuf-private.h. * gdk-pixbuf/Makefile.am (libgdk_pixbuf_la_LDFLAGS): Incremented the version number of the libtool library to indicate that this definitely is not compatible with the old usage.
